Accepted Offer – Interviewed in Jun 2011 – Reviewed Apr 6, 2012
Interview Details – First interview was over the phone with HR person. It included standard questions on why I want the position, what is my background and skills. Second interview was with team and included behavioral, skills and experience questions. And final interview was with a director asking again behavioral questions.
Interview Question – What are you weaknesses and strengths? How would you deal with a certain problem? What would be your plan in a certain situation? Answer Question
Negotiation Details – I was happy with the offer and did not negotiate.
